> > The IPI hypercalls depend on being able to map the Linux notion of CPU ID
> > to the hypervisor's notion of the CPU ID. The array hv_vp_index[] provides
> > this mapping. Code for populating this array depends on the IPI
> functionality.
> > Break this circular dependency.
